Output c701171eb03076d8ebf26a8e38ef58c699b1a9e9c7ff7cf1707f45b52d91b746:0

value
9881594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f76fa54502abb722a188243eb5555f7da4b45178 OP_EQUAL
address
3QFLaCP9iKWYrSXL8bcsYgGwhhJKAAXBgS
transaction
c701171eb03076d8ebf26a8e38ef58c699b1a9e9c7ff7cf1707f45b52d91b746
confirmations
377782
spent
true